Samsung Galaxy Tab A 9.7 & S Pen

Please find below the detailed specs for the Samsung Galaxy Tab A 9.7 & S Pen.
| NETWORK | Technology | GSM / HSPA / LTE |
| 2G bands | GSM 850 / 900 / 1800 / 1900 | |
| 3G bands | HSDPA 850 / 900 / 1900 / 2100 | |
| 4G bands | LTE band 1(2100), 3(1800), 5(850), 7(2600), 8(900), 20(800), 28(700), 40(2300) | |
| Speed | HSPA, LTE Cat4 150/50 Mbps | |
| GPRS | Yes | |
| EDGE | Yes | |
| LAUNCH | Announced | 2015, July |
| BODY | Dimensions | 242.5 x 166.8 x 7.5 mm (9.55 x 6.57 x 0.30 in) |
| Weight | 490 g (1.08 lb) | |
| SIM | Micro-SIM | |
| – Stylus | ||
| DISPLAY | Type | TFT capacitive touchscreen, 16M colors |
| Size | 9.7 inches, 291.4 cm2 (~72.0% screen-to-body ratio) | |
| Resolution | 768 x 1024 pixels, 4:3 ratio (~132 ppi density) | |
| Multitouch | Yes | |
| PLATFORM | OS | Android 5.0 (Lollipop) |
| CPU | Quad-core 1.2 GHz | |
| MEMORY | Card slot | microSD, up to 256 GB (dedicated slot) |
| Internal | 16 GB, 2 GB RAM | |
| CAMERA | Primary | 5 MP, autofocus |
| Features | Geo-tagging | |
| Video | 720p | |
| Secondary | 2 MP | |
| SOUND | Alert types | Yes |
| Loudspeaker | Yes, dual speakers | |
| 3.5mm jack | Yes | |
| COMMS | WLAN |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n, dual-band, WiFi Direct, hotspot |
| Bluetooth | 4.1, A2DP | |
| GPS | Yes, with A-GPS, GLONASS, BDS | |
| Radio | No | |
| USB | microUSB 2.0 | |
| FEATURES | Sensors | Accelerometer, compass |
| Messaging | Email, Push Mail, IM | |
| Browser | HTML5 | |
| – MP4/H.264 player | ||
| – MP3/WAV/eAAC+/Flac player | ||
| – Photo/video editor | ||
| – Document viewer | ||
| BATTERY | Non-removable Li-Ion 6000 mAh battery | |
| Talk time | Up to 14 h 30 min (multimedia) (2G) / Up to 40 h (3G) | |
| Music play | Up to 178 h | |
| MISC | Colors | Black, White, Gray |
| SAR | 1.47 W/kg (body) | |
| SAR EU | 0.83 W/kg (body) | |
| Price | About 340 EUR | |
